Prof.Shepbard t-ava of tbe analyBis made j,
October 10, 1809 : "A valuable manure k
and <)eci iecily superior to the article of 2
last yetr."
Experiment made by M. C. M. Hammond,
of Beech Inland. S. C.:
No manure, 887 11m. Seed Cotton per
acre. 175 lbs. Peruvian Gunno, 1328 1b?.
Seed Cotton per acre. 175 lbs. Baugb'n
1489 llis. Seed Cotton fer acre.

CITIZENS' SAYINGS BANK
O F
SOUTH CAROLINA. A
^ wil
per
Dffico Bank Building, Abbeville C. H. a3
? m
Current Deposits of $1.00 and Ma
upwards Received. Gold
Deposits payable in j]/
gold, received by ^
agreement
nrith the Assistant Cashier.
Interest allowed at the rate of Six n/IMIIUiM
1 -
? J'OI UIIIIM//I, CUI/IJJUtllLU- Ul
ed every /Six Months.
PRINCIPAL and Interest, or any part *"V
thereof, m?y be withdrawn at any
irne?the Bank reserving the right (though at ?|
twill be rarely exercised) to^deinand four- Bew
ecn days' notice if the amount is under _Fj
1,000 ; twenty day9 if over $1,000 and
mder $5,000, or thirty d?ys if over
>5,000.
